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Driveway: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of the Concrete: Thicker concrete slabs provide more durability but also come at a higher price.
- Type of Concrete: Different types of concrete, such as standard, reinforced, or stamped, vary in cost.
- Site Preparation: The need for excavation, grading, or removal of old concrete can add to the expenses.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Newburgh, IN, can vary based on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can delay the project and increase costs due to extended labor hours or additional materials.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, which come with additional fees.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Newburgh, IN)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Pouring | $4 - $7 per square foot |
Stamped Concrete | $8 - $12 per square foot |
Reinforced Concrete | $9 - $13 per square foot |
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,500 |
Removal of Old Driveway |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
